Sorry, but that is the wrong advice. The crossover from the mids in those Def Techs is 125 Hz. If he follows your advice then he will have crossovers only 5 Hz apart!
This is part of his problem. Those Def Tecks pose pretty much an impossible integration problem. Def Tech recommend setting 80 Hz, which only half an octave apart, which is another train wreck. If anything the crossover needs to go down to about 40 Hz to get a decent spread between the crossovers.
The best advice is not to use those bass drivers, and use external subs, but the OP says he does not have room for them.
Actually Dirac probably did set the crossover close, as that is nearly an octave apart, but 40 Hz may well be better.
The issue here is how to make the best of a bad job, and that is never a good place to be.
